  • Patent number: 7757728
    Abstract: A funnel with a shut-off valve terminates the flow of fluid from a reservoir to a spout passageway upon activation of the shut-off valve. The flow of fluid is terminated when a float contacts a seal mounted within the spout passageway. An upper magnet is mounted above the seal and a lower magnet is attached to the float, a portion of which extends over the lower magnet. In the open position, the force provided between the magnets serves to provide lift to the float. When the fluid level in the container rises, additional lift is provided until the lower magnet comes sufficiently within the range of the upper magnet causing the lower magnet to be drawn to the upper magnet. The force between the magnets is sufficient to provide compression of the seal by the float. A ball joint is provided between a control rod and the float to correct misalignment between the float and the seal.

  • Patent number: 5515892
    Abstract: A funnel (20) for use in dumping volatile solvents into an underlying carboy (16) is ecologically friendly in that it blocks solvent from evaporating from the carboy into the atmosphere. The funnel has (a) an extended stem (22), the bottom open end of which is below the surface of the solvent (18) in the carboy to reduce surface evaporation, (b) an occluder or obturating ball (24) in the throat of the funnel to block evaporation through the stem of the funnel, and (c) a lid (28) on the funnel to block evaporation. The ball may be float operated, with or without a captivating cage (26), or it may be operated by lifting the lid, which may be performed manually or via a foot pedal (38).

  • Patent number: 5293912
    Abstract: A wine breather is disclosed which comprises a cylindrical and horn shaped container (10) which tapers downwardly from an inlet (12) to an outlet (14). A valve (16) is arranged at the outlet which has an annular outlet passage (42) angled at a transverse angle to the longitudinal axis of the container (10). Wine is poured into the open end (12) and passes through the container (10) to exit the passage (42) in a thin sheet forming a generally hemispherical flow of wine which presents a substantially large surface area of wine for contact with the air to cause the wine to breathe.
